Hallo zum Forum

harryk

Neues Mitglied
07. Dez. 2012
7
0
0
Sprachen
  1. Assembler
Hallo zum Forum,

mein Name ist Horst, aber Harry genannt.
Ich habe schon einige Jahre Erfahrung mit der 8-Bit-Familie der AVR-Controller. Ich betreibe das Ganze als Hobby und baue hier und da für Freunde oder für mich selbst irgendwelche Steuerungen oder Schaltungen wie es gerade nötig ist. Ich bin schon etwas älter (bj 1943) und habe demnach dafür auch ausreichend Zeit :)

Ich habe viele Jahre die Avr-Controller ausschließlich mit Assembler programmiert. Bei großen Projekten macht das Ganze natürlich manchmal mehr Aufwand als Nutzen. Da ich aus dem alten Beruf Erfahrungen in Pascal sammeln konnte, habe ich mich ca. vor einem Jahr auch den Hochsprachen für AVR-Controller zugewandt. Die Pascal-Varianten für den AVR sagten mir jedoch weniger zu, C liegt mir scheinbar auch nicht so richtig. Meine Versuche starteten dann mit Bascom, da es überall empfohlen wird. Durch Pascal-Erfahrungen fühlte ich mich aber irgendwie eingeschränkt (wirkt etwas altbacken) und nun probiere ich es seit ca. 1/2 Jahr erfolgreich mit Luna und werde dabei wohl auch bleiben.

So viel zu mir, ich hoffe man schreibt sich,
Gruß vom Harry :)
 
Hallo Harry,

herzlich willkommen im Forum :flowers:

Pascal hab ich ganz früher mal programmiert (so etwa 25 Jahre her). Es ist eine schöne Sprache die zum sauberen Aufbau zwingt :cool: Alles sehr strukturiert und sortiert.

Ich hab mir das "Was ist Luna?" mal kurz durchgelesen ... hört sich interessant an :D

Gruß
Dino
 
Hallo Harry,

herzlich willkommen im AVR-Praxis-Forum! :)

Luna ist mir auch neu, es scheint eine Alternative zu BascomAVR zu sein ... hört sich für mich auch interessant an. Bestimmt werden sich einige Bascom-Spezialisten Luna einmal genauer ansehen :D

So, dann wünsche ich dir noch viel Spaß bei uns!

Dirk :ciao:
 
Hallo,

danke für die Begrüßung. :)

Hallo Harry,

herzlich willkommen im Forum :flowers:

Pascal hab ich ganz früher mal programmiert (so etwa 25 Jahre her). Es ist eine schöne Sprache die zum sauberen Aufbau zwingt :cool: Alles sehr strukturiert und sortiert.

Ich hab mir das "Was ist Luna?" mal kurz durchgelesen ... hört sich interessant an :D

Gruß
Dino

Nun das genau ist der Punkt, wenn man einmal in einer Hochsprache gezwungenermaßen "ästhetisch" programmiert, gewöhnt man sich das schnell an. Hier war mir Bascom dann doch etwas zu sehr Basic. Das Luna ist wohl auch noch ein recht junges Projekt, wohl so ca. 1 Jahr wenn ich das richtig gesehen habe und seit ca. 1/2 wirklich produktiv einsetzbar. Ich verfolge das schon eine ganze Weile. Da tut sich eine Menge.

Ich hoffe ich kann hier im Forum ein paar sinnvolle Beiträge leisten. Meine Erfahrungen kann man als Fortgeschritten bezeichnen, wodurch ich vielleicht nicht ganz so viele Fragen habe. Bei Assembler und Luna helfe ich gern.

Harry
 
Hallo Harry!

Willkommen im AVR-Praxis Forum! :ciao:


Ich habe mir auf Grund deines Hinweises jetzt auch mal LUNA angesehen und muss sagen, es macht einen sehr interessanten Eindruck.
OK, das Projekt ist noch recht jung und bietet bei Weiten noch nicht die vielen Möglichkeiten, wie BASCOM durch die LIB`s zu bestimmter Hardware, aber das kann ja noch kommen.

Wenn ich das am Beispiel für ein standard LCD allerdings richtig verstanden habe, dann kann man sich auch relativ einfach selber einige Hardware-Ansteuerungen schreiben und diese dann mit INCLUDE hinzufügen. :)
Man muss also nicht zwanghaft auf eine LIB oder ähnliches warten.

Ich danke dir also für den Hinweis mit LUNA und wenn ich Fragen habe, dann melde ich mich schon. :D


Da du aber bereits schon einige Sachen programmiert und gebaut hast, kannst du einiges davon aber auch gern mal hier vorstellen.
Es geht also nicht nur darum ob jemand Fragen hat, wenn er sich in einem Forum anmeldet. :cool:



Grüße und viel Spaß hier,
Cassio
 
Hallo Harry,

Ich hoffe ich kann hier im Forum ein paar sinnvolle Beiträge leisten. Meine Erfahrungen kann man als Fortgeschritten bezeichnen, wodurch ich vielleicht nicht ganz so viele Fragen habe. Bei Assembler und Luna helfe ich gern.
Das was mich an Bascom ein wenig stört ist der doch recht aufgeblähte Code der bei der Compilierung entsteht. C ist da ne Ecke besser. Bei C stört mich aber die kryptische Einbindung von Assembler. Bei Luna hab ich Sprachansätze von Java gesehen. Mit Java stehe ich allerdings total auf Kriegsfuß :rolleyes:

Also eine saubere Sprache wie Pascal mit dem kompakten Ergebnis von C, der einfachen Assembler-Einbindung von Bascom und mit schönen einfachen Befehlen wie Pascal oder Bascom. Das wär mal was. Mit diesem ganzen objektorientierten Kram hab ich nocht so viel im Sinn :p

Wenn du deine Erfahrungen zu Luna hier reinschreiben würdest wär das echt interessant. Dann könnte man sich mal ein genaueres Bild machen wie sich das so im Einsatz macht.

Gruß
Dino
 
Hallo Cassio,

OK, das Projekt ist noch recht jung und bietet bei Weiten noch nicht die vielen Möglichkeiten, wie BASCOM durch die LIB`s zu bestimmter Hardware, aber das kann ja noch kommen.

beim Funktionsumfang täuscht man sich etwas. Die Möglichkeiten der Sprache selbst sind enorm und überragen die von Bascom schon merklich wenn man damit arbeitet. Die fest implementierten Objekte zu bestimmter Hardware sind aus meiner Sicht kein Vergleichskriterium, mir fällt da auf Anhieb nicht ganz so viel ein was fehlt. Wenn man sich die verfügbaren Beispiele ansieht, bin ich bisher wunschlos glücklich. Meine Erfahrungen teile ich natürlich gern mit euch, ich werde dafür aber besser ein eigenes Thema eröffnen, dann habe ich wenigstens ein Thema zum Schreiben. :)

Gruß vom Harry
 

Über uns

  • Makerconnect ist ein Forum, welches wir ausschließlich für einen Gedankenaustausch und als Diskussionsplattform für Interessierte bereitstellen, welche sich privat, durch das Studium oder beruflich mit Mikrocontroller- und Kleinstrechnersystemen beschäftigen wollen oder müssen ;-)
  • Dirk
  • Du bist noch kein Mitglied in unserer freundlichen Community? Werde Teil von uns und registriere dich in unserem Forum.
  •  Registriere dich

User Menu

 Kaffeezeit

  • Wir arbeiten hart daran sicherzustellen, dass unser Forum permanent online und schnell erreichbar ist, unsere Forensoftware auf dem aktuellsten Stand ist und der Server regelmäßig gewartet wird. Auch die Themen Datensicherheit und Datenschutz sind uns wichtig und hier sind wir auch ständig aktiv. Alles in allem, sorgen wir uns darum, dass alles Drumherum stimmt :-)

    Dir gefällt das Forum und unsere Arbeit und du möchtest uns unterstützen? Unterstütze uns durch deine Premium-Mitgliedschaft!
    Wir freuen uns auch über eine Spende für unsere Kaffeekasse :-)
    Vielen Dank! :ciao:


     Spende uns! (Paypal)